    This Halcyon Classics ebook is F. Scott Fitzgerald's Jazz Age Classic THE BEAUTIFUL AND DAMNED. The novel tells the story of Anthony Patch, a young presumptive heir to a fortune and his relationship with his wife Gloria. Patch serves in the army and struggles with alcoholism as he seeks a greater meaning to his life. The novel provides an excellent portrait of the Eastern elite during the 1920s ... Read more

    Tender Is the Night is an English language novel by F. Scott Fitzgerald. It was first published in Scribner's Magazine between January-April, 1934 in four issues. It is ranked #28 on the Modern Library's list of the 100 Greatest Novels of the 20th Century.In 1932, Fitzgerald's wife Zelda Sayre Fitzgerald was hospitalized for schizophrenia in Baltimore, Maryland.     An important historical work, "The Red Record" is also a horrifying account of African American lynchings after the Civil War. Black Americans lost their lives for such offenses as offending a white person in some way, proposing marriage to a white woman, providing information to someone who asked, introducing smallpox, "conjuring," and/or writing a letter to a white woman.
